Output 7e95dd7f63d8635f5049451aeba20d6123dc3c60d40c10c580ce5e5c6da811d1:20

value
1057602
script pubkey
OP_0 OP_PUSHBYTES_32 10bb8c4cf9ed3dbd85cc2b1a84808f0dcb2acb6c3e7198298fea211452047374
address
bc1qzzaccn8ea57mmpwv9vdgfqy0ph9j4jmv8eces2v0ags3g5sywd6qn5k6t2
transaction
7e95dd7f63d8635f5049451aeba20d6123dc3c60d40c10c580ce5e5c6da811d1
confirmations
171148
spent
true